Multiple Warning Alarms
• Multiple audio and visual alarms may not be easily distinguishable from one another (McLeod et al., 2005).
• McLeod, Walker & Mills (2005) concludes that Extended AWS has increased the risk of driver unreliability rather than reduce it.

Automatic Cancellation of Warnings
• 56% of drivers “automatically” cancelled an AWS warning
• Drivers response is highly learnt and/or anticipatory in nature. (McLeod et al., 2005)
